diff --git a/hyfetch/neofetch_util.py b/hyfetch/neofetch_util.py index 6977c588..cb99be63 100644 --- a/hyfetch/neofetch_util.py +++ b/hyfetch/neofetch_util.py @@ -11,3 +11,13 @@ def get_command_path() -> str: :return: Command path """ return pkg_resources.resource_filename(__name__, 'scripts/neofetch_mod.sh') + + +def get_distro_ascii_lines() -> int: + """ + Get how many lines are in the distro ascii + + :return: Number of lines + """ + out = check_output([get_command_path(), "print_ascii"]) + return len(out.decode().strip().split('\n'))